The Ultimate Buying Guide: A Purrfect Choice for Your Feline Friend
Cats are curious creatures. They love to play and explore. Sometimes, you can’t always be there to entertain them. That’s where self-play cat toys come in handy! These toys keep your furry friend busy and happy. This guide helps you pick the best ones.
1. Key Features to Look For
Interactive Elements
Look for toys that move on their own. Many toys have motion sensors. They wiggle, spin, or light up when your cat is near. Some toys have feathers or balls that dangle. These mimic prey, sparking your cat’s hunting instincts.
Durability
Cats can be rough with their toys. Choose toys made from strong materials. They should withstand scratching and biting. A well-made toy lasts longer. It saves you money in the long run.
Safety
Always check the materials. Make sure there are no small parts that can come off. These can be a choking hazard. The toy should be non-toxic. It’s best to avoid toys with sharp edges.
Variety
Cats get bored easily. Having a few different types of self-play toys is a good idea. Consider a laser pointer, a puzzle feeder, or a motorized ball. Variety keeps playtime exciting.
Power Source
Some toys use batteries. Others are rechargeable. Rechargeable toys are more eco-friendly. They also save you money on batteries. Check how long the battery lasts.
2. Important Materials
The materials used are very important. They affect safety and durability.
- Felt and Fleece: These are soft and safe for cats. They are good for scratching and biting.
- Plastics: Durable plastics are common. Look for BPA-free plastics. They are safer for your cat.
- Feathers and Natural Fibers: These mimic real prey. They are attractive to cats. Make sure they are securely attached.
- Catnip: Many toys are infused with catnip. This makes them more appealing to cats.
3.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
What Makes a Toy Great?
- Good Construction: Seams should be strong. Parts should be well-attached.
- Engaging Movements: Predictable or random movements keep cats interested.
- Quiet Operation: Loud toys can scare some cats.
- Easy to Clean: Some toys can be wiped down or washed.
What Makes a Toy Less Ideal?
- Cheaply Made: Toys that fall apart quickly are a waste of money.
- Limited Functionality: Toys that do only one thing might bore your cat fast.
- Unpleasant Smells: Strong chemical smells can deter cats.
- Small, Detachable Parts: These are a safety concern.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: What are the main benefits of self-play cat toys?
A: They provide exercise and mental stimulation. They keep cats entertained when you’re not around. They also help reduce boredom and stress.
Q: Are self-play toys safe for all cats?
A: Yes, when chosen carefully. Always check for small parts and non-toxic materials. Supervise your cat during initial play sessions.
Q: How often should I replace self-play cat toys?
A: Replace toys that are damaged or have loose parts. Worn-out toys are less engaging and can be unsafe.
Q: My cat seems uninterested in a self-play toy. What can I do?
A: Try different types of toys. Some cats prefer certain movements or sounds. You can also try introducing the toy gradually.
Q: Can self-play toys help with my cat’s weight?
A: Yes, active play helps burn calories. Toys that encourage chasing and pouncing are good for weight management.
Q: Are rechargeable toys better than battery-operated ones?
A: Rechargeable toys are often more cost-effective and eco-friendly. Battery-operated toys offer more flexibility in placement.
Q: What is the best self-play toy for a kitten?
A: Kittens have lots of energy. Lighter, interactive toys with feathers or crinkle sounds are usually a hit. Avoid toys with small, easily chewed parts.
Q: Can I leave self-play toys out all the time?
A: It’s a good idea to rotate toys. This keeps them novel and exciting. Also, put away toys that might pose a hazard when unsupervised.
Q: How do I clean self-play cat toys?
A: Check the manufacturer’s instructions. Many fabric toys can be wiped down. Some electronic toys have removable parts that can be cleaned.
Q: My cat is a strong chewer. What kind of toys should I look for?
A: For strong chewers, look for toys made of durable rubber or tough, reinforced fabric. Avoid toys with stuffing that can be easily pulled out.
